Staff Engineer - Java (HYBRID)

GEICO

Actively hiring
Remote (Md Bethesda Office, US) Posted 37 days ago $100,000$230,000 / year

At a glance

AI generated

TL;DR

We are seeking a Senior Software Engineer to join our dynamic and innovative data engineering team at GEICO. This role involves designing and implementing robust data solutions using Apache Trino and other cutting-edge technologies to enhance our big data analytics capabilities. You will work closely with cross-functional teams to build scalable, high-performance systems that support real-time data processing and analysis for millions of users. Key responsibilities include developing efficient query execution plans, optimizing database performance, and ensuring seamless integration with existing infrastructure. Ideal candidates should have extensive experience in Java or Scala, along with a deep understanding of distributed computing frameworks and SQL databases. Familiarity with cloud platforms like AWS is also beneficial as we operate at large scale to address complex business challenges in the insurance industry.

Skills

Apache_Trino

What you'll do

  • Design and implement data processing solutions using Apache Trino.
  • Optimize query performance for large-scale data sets.
  • Develop ETL processes to integrate diverse data sources.
  • Maintain and troubleshoot data infrastructure for reliability.
  • Document technical designs and procedures for team reference.

What we're looking for

  • 5+ years of experience in data engineering and analytics.
  • Proficiency in Apache Trino and other big data technologies.
  • Strong SQL skills for efficient data querying and manipulation.
  • Experience with cloud platforms like AWS or Azure for data solutions.
  • Bachelor’s degree in Computer Science, Engineering, or related field.
  • Excellent problem-solving abilities and attention to detail.

Market check

Salary context

This $100,000–$230,000 range sits above 36% of similar postings on FindRole.

Peer median band

$120,000$230,000

Median floor and ceiling across peers.

Typical midpoint (25–75%)

$156,000$214,500

Middle half of comparable postings.

Based on 240 comparable postings.

* 240 is the maximum number of comparable postings sampled.

Employer

About GEICO

GEICO (Government Employees Insurance Company) is one of the largest auto insurers in the United States, offering affordable auto, home, renters, and other personal insurance products. Industry: Insurance

GEICO currently has 128 open roles on FindRole.

Listed pay typically runs $110,000–$230,000 across 128 roles with salary data.

Most-posted roles

View all roles at GEICO

More like this

Similar roles

Staff Engineer - Java (API/Software Development/Microservices)

GEICO

Remote (Md Bethesda Office, US) 42 days ago $100,000$230,000
Apache_Trino AI_productivity_tools Applied_AI_technologies CI/CD Python Java Kubernetes AWS Azure Google_Cloud Docker Terraform Git Jenkins PostgreSQL MongoDB Redis Kafka Prometheus Grafana
Remote